Preparing the car for a long journey with children: comfort and safety above all else

Travelling by car with children can be an exciting adventure, but it requires careful preparation to ensure the comfort and safety of all passengers. Before travelling, be sure to check the condition of the brakes, suspension, steering, lights and windscreen wipers. Make sure all systems are working properly.

Check the level and condition of engine oil, coolant, brake fluid and washer fluid. Replace them if necessary. Also replace the air filter and cabin filter. Check tyre pressure and tread condition. Make sure that the tread depth meets safety standards. Replace the tyres if necessary.

Child safety:

  • Child Car Seat: Make sure the child car seat is appropriate for the child’s age and weight, properly installed and securely fastened.
  • Sun protection: Install sun shades on windows to protect children from direct sunlight.
  • First aid kit: Assemble a first aid kit that includes necessary medicines, bandages, plasters, antiseptics and other first aid supplies for your child.

Comfort and entertainment:

Interior cleanliness: Clean the interior of the vehicle thoroughly before travelling to ensure a comfortable and hygienic environment for children. Children often soil the seats with food, drinks, crumbs and other substances. The covers are easily removable and washable to keep the car seat clean and hygienic. Moisture and food residue can be a breeding ground for bacteria and germs. Covers help prevent this, keeping your child safe and healthy.

Allergen protection: Child car seat covers can protect your child from allergens such as dust, pollen and animal hair that can build up on the upholstery of the car seat.




Covers made of soft materials such as cotton or fleece provide additional comfort for the child, especially in cold weather. They prevent your child’s delicate skin from rubbing against the seat upholstery, especially in hot weather.

Additional features: Some covers have additional features, such as pockets for storing toys or bottles, making travelling more convenient for parents and children.


When choosing car covers, consider your needs, budget and the way your car is used. The right covers will not only protect the seats, but will also make your car more comfortable and stylish.

  1.  Universal covers: This is the most common and affordable type of cover. They fit most car models and come in a wide range of colours and materials. However, universal covers do not always fit perfectly on the seats and may slip off.
  2. Model covers: These covers are individually designed for each car model, so they perfectly follow the shape of the seats and take into account all the design features (headrests, armrests, side airbags). Model covers look like original upholstery and provide maximum protection.
  3. Mike covers: This is a budget option that protects only the most vulnerable parts of the seats – the backrest and seat. T-shirt covers are easy to put on and take off, but do not provide full protection.
